Up first, I wanted to showhow pretty the Hugs and Kisses Cover-Up looks when used to emboss instead of cut.  This is the Primitive Cream card stock and I just adore it - treat yourself you will LOVE it.  The stamp set is Love Story and it is brimming with gorgeous, love-filled sentiments.  

I stamped with Versamark ink, then heat embossed with Detail White embossing powder.  To give a real chalkboard effect, I lightly rubbed the finished piece with my Whip Cream ink and a sponge dauber.

Here's a peek at the gorgeous new TRANSFORM-ables Heart full of Love Die-namics.  It is so easy to create this beautiful overlay using this new die set.  This is a clean and simple card design for me, I usually want to add a gajillion layers but I settled on the new bold graphic Patterned Triangles Background stamped in Whip Cream pigment ink. The pigment ink from MFT will require just a bit more drying time, or a zap with your heat tool, but the effect is dreamy.


I also added a trio of enamel dots in this pretty olive color.   The overlay was cut from the new Grout Gray card stock.  To do this you use the cut & re-cut technique pairing the two heart shaped dies in this set.  It's a breeze!  The overlay was set on top of a Electric Red heart for a big POP of color.

Inspired by the frigid cold winter we're having I used the new Centerpieces Framed Lovebirds and cut the branches from corrugated cardboard.  Two pretty red birds are sitting (and freezing) on these bare trees, just like the ones I can spy from my kitchen. With the help of some white paint and some fine glitter, these trees have any icy snowy coating.


The birdies are backed with a bit of Sno Cone card stock.  The lovely thing about this die design is that it really does most of your card design work for you.
